Duties: Turner Broadcasting System, Inc. is seeking an HR Client Specialist (HRCS) to serve as a member of Turner s employee service center. The HRCS will be a member of the service center leadership team interacting with the HR organization, critical internal and external corporate partners; operate as a subject matter resource and consultant to the HR Generalist community (i.e. policy interpretation and process administration); provide escalation support to service center representatives; act as a project lead for audit initiatives and compliance requirements. The HRCS with report directly to the Director of HR Shared Services.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Contribute to the efforts to build strong, collaborative partnerships with key business partners across the Turner and Time Warner communities in support of the service offerings of the service center
- Partner with HR Generalists to proactively manage inquiries, requests and service transactions from initiation through resolution to ensure efficient and accurate handling. Manage service center relationship with HR Generalist community, along with Director.
- Development and maintenance of process flows and narratives, as well as other foundational resource materials for the HR community.
- Identify and recommend opportunities to change processes for improved operational efficiency.
- Assist Director with assembling and analyzing metrics and trends related to service inquiries and requests processed within the service center
- Lead service center efforts related to internal compliance initiatives associated with state and federal regulations, in addition to internal HR initiatives
- Actively engage with other service center management members in the evaluation and continued evolution and enhancement of the service offerings and customer service levels by the service center to the employee and HR communities
- Administration of day-to-day tasks associated with service offerings to include completion of employment verifications; oversight of compliance related to I-9 certification; resolution of unemployment claims inquiries and reconciliation and submission of employee referral bonus program payments
- Conduct periodic and routine audits of process adherence and data integrity to include participation in the completion of quarterly internal and external SOX audit procedures
